WebNov 10, 2024 · Female rabbits build their nests covered with their fur, brush, twigs, and grasses. A female rabbit can have around 1-12 babies per litter. During the breeding season, they can have five litters. Rabbits are usually pregnant for 31 days. Kits are born in cozy nests built by their mothers.
